Clovis (CVN) to Tocumen (PTY)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Clovis Regional Airport (CVN) in Clovis, United States to Tocumen International Airport (PTY) in Tocumen, Panama is 3,713 kilometers (2,307 miles / 2,005 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 5h, flying southeast at a heading of 134°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is an international route connecting United States with Panama.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 06:09 in Clovis, it's 08:09 in Tocumen.

There is a significant elevation difference of 4,081 feet between the two airports. Tocumen International Airport sits lower than Clovis Regional Airport.

The return flight from Tocumen (PTY) to Clovis (CVN) follows a heading of 323° (northw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
